Bone Cold Justice
Defeat an enemy by hitting back a Skeleton's bone.

Another solution that works for any character:
When an enemy skeleton throws a bone at you, normally if you strike it with your weapon it'll just disintegrate. However, if you hit it right after it leaves his hand, it will deflect back at him or whatever is behind him.
On the first stage, there's a room with two small swinging pendulums, fairly close to the boss area. On the bottom of this room are 4 skeletons. When the first one throws a bone, smack it with something, it'll kill something behind him, achievement get.

I highly recommend using Jonathan. When you near a group of enemies with a skeleton, stand close to skeleton and hold down X and move the left analog to flail your whip doing little damage to skeleton but knocking his bone into another enemy. Way easier than trying to time your attacks IMO.

If you are going solely for this achievement the earliest i've noticed you can get this is on the first stage right at the beginning.
After you start, move right into the next room and jump on the moving platform to go up. Keep jumping up into the next room and you will see a skeleton on the right and left. Hop over to the left.
Here you will want to jump and hit a bone in mid air which will make it fly back and hit another skeleton in the rear. For this i used alucard but im sure you can use any character as long as you time it right.

I got this trophy naturally during Chapter 1. You need to hit a Skeleton's bone while in the air so it deflects back at the Skeleton and destroys it (or another enemy). The bone must be hit while it is going up into the air. If the bone is coming down to the ground, it will destroy the bone rather than deflect it.

The trophy can also be obtained by killing an enemy using a summoned skeleton from Charlotte or Soma.

A bone thrown by a skeleton can only be returned at the beginning of the throw, so it is often easier to return it to another enemy, because you'll most likely kill the bone-throwing skeleton.
